探索优雅前端设计:Macaron CSS框架
项目简介
是一个轻量级、响应式的CSS框架,旨在简化前端开发过程,提供一致且美观的设计方案。该项目的目标是帮助开发者快速构建界面,同时保持代码简洁和易于维护。其灵感来源于法国马卡龙甜点,寓意其精致且多样的设计元素。
技术分析
Macaron CSS 基于SASS(Syntactically Awesome Style Sheets)预处理器,这使得它支持变量、嵌套规则、混合模式等功能,提高了代码的可读性和可复用性。框架的核心特性包括:
- 响应式布局:Macaron CSS 集成了Flexbox网格系统,可以根据设备屏幕大小自动调整布局,确保在不同设备上都有良好的用户体验。
- 模块化设计:组件被划分为独立的模块,如按钮、表单、导航等,方便按需引入,降低页面加载负担。
- 无障碍访问(A11Y):遵循Web Content Accessibility Guidelines(WCAG),确保残障人士也能方便地访问网站。
- 易于定制:由于基于SASS,你可以轻松地自定义主题,更改颜色、字体和其他样式。
- 优化的性能:通过最小化文件大小和利用CDN,Macaron CSS 提供了快速的加载速度。
应用场景
Macaron CSS 可广泛应用于各种类型的网页项目,无论你是要创建一个新的博客、电子商务平台,还是需要改进现有的网站,都可以借助此框架实现:
- 快速原型设计:借助其预设的样式和组件,可以迅速搭建出页面的基本结构。
- 企业网站:稳定的响应式设计和易于定制的主题,适合打造专业的企业形象。
- 个人项目:轻量级的特性使其成为个人博客或作品集的理想选择。
- 教育和非营利组织:免费、开源的性质,为这些组织提供了经济高效的前端解决方案。
特点与优势
- 简单易学:即使是对CSS不熟悉的开发者,也能快速上手。
- 社区支持:开源项目意味着有活跃的社区进行问题解答和技术更新。
- 兼容性:Macaron CSS 已经经过广泛的浏览器测试,确保在现代浏览器中良好运行。
- 持续更新:开发团队不断改进和完善项目,以适应最新的Web标准。
结语
如果你正在寻找一个能提高开发效率,同时提供优美设计的CSS框架,Macaron CSS 绝对值得尝试。它的轻量级、响应式和模块化设计,将帮助你在创建网页时,更好地聚焦于内容本身而非琐碎的样式细节。立即加入Macaron CSS 的世界,让您的项目变得更加迷人吧!